Introduction
In the early 21st century, the advent of smartphones revolutionized the way we interact with technology. At the heart of this revolution lies mobile applications, commonly referred to as apps, which have become an integral part of our daily lives. From social networking and communication to health monitoring and entertainment, mobile apps have transformed the digital landscape. This article explores the evolution of mobile applications, their impact on various sectors, and the potential future developments in this ever-growing industry.
The Evolution of Mobile Applications
The journey of mobile applications began with the launch of the first mobile phone in 1973 by Motorola. However, it wasn’t until the introduction of smartphones that mobile apps gained significant traction. The earliest apps were simple, with basic features like calculators, calendars, and games. The true evolution began with the launch of Apple’s iPhone in 2007, followed by the introduction of the App Store in 2008, which opened the floodgates for third-party developers to create and distribute apps.
- Early Days: WAP and J2ME Applications
- Before the era of smartphones, mobile applications were limited in functionality. Wireless Application Protocol (WAP) and Java 2 Platform, Micro Edition (J2ME) were among the first platforms that enabled developers to create mobile applications. These apps were rudimentary and often text-based, offering limited interaction due to hardware constraints.
- The Rise of iOS and Android
- The launch of the iPhone and subsequently Android phones marked a significant turning point. The iOS App Store and Google Play Store became central hubs for users to discover, download, and update apps. The ease of distribution and the potential for revenue generation spurred a massive increase in app development. Developers began creating apps for every conceivable purpose, leading to the exponential growth of mobile applications.
- Cross-Platform Development and Hybrid Apps
- As the market expanded, so did the need for apps that could run on multiple platforms without requiring separate codebases. This led to the development of cross-platform frameworks like Xamarin, React Native, and Flutter. Hybrid apps, which combine elements of native apps and web apps, became popular due to their cost-effectiveness and ease of maintenance.
The Impact of Mobile Applications
Mobile applications have had a profound impact on various sectors, fundamentally altering how businesses operate and how consumers interact with products and services.
- Healthcare and Fitness
- Mobile apps have revolutionized the healthcare industry by providing users with easy access to medical information, remote consultations, and fitness tracking. Apps like MyFitnessPal and Fitbit have empowered individuals to take control of their health, while telemedicine apps like Teladoc have made healthcare more accessible, especially in remote areas.
- E-commerce
- The rise of e-commerce can be largely attributed to mobile applications. Apps like Amazon, eBay, and Shopify have made shopping more convenient, allowing users to browse, purchase, and track orders with a few taps on their smartphones. Mobile payments, facilitated by apps like PayPal and Apple Pay, have further streamlined the online shopping experience.
- Social Networking
- Social media platforms like Facebook, Instagram, and Twitter have harnessed the power of mobile apps to build vast user communities. These apps have redefined how we communicate, share information, and interact with one another. The integration of features like live streaming, stories, and direct messaging has enhanced user engagement and connectivity.
- Education
- Mobile apps have transformed the education sector by making learning more accessible and interactive. Educational apps like Duolingo, Coursera, and Khan Academy provide users with the opportunity to learn new skills and subjects at their own pace. The COVID-19 pandemic further accelerated the adoption of mobile apps in education, as remote learning became the norm.
- Entertainment
- The entertainment industry has also benefited immensely from mobile applications. Streaming services like Netflix, Spotify, and YouTube have made it easier for users to access a vast array of content, from movies and TV shows to music and podcasts. Gaming apps, in particular, have seen explosive growth, with titles like PUBG Mobile and Candy Crush Saga attracting millions of users worldwide.
- Finance and Banking
- Mobile banking apps have transformed the way we manage our finances. Apps from major banks, along with fintech solutions like Venmo and Robinhood, offer users the ability to conduct transactions, monitor account balances, and even invest in stocks from the convenience of their smartphones. This has not only improved financial literacy but also increased financial inclusion.
Challenges in Mobile Application Development
Despite their widespread adoption, the development and maintenance of mobile applications come with several challenges.
- Platform Fragmentation
- One of the biggest challenges is platform fragmentation. With numerous versions of operating systems and a wide variety of devices, ensuring that an app functions seamlessly across all platforms is a daunting task. This is especially true for Android, where there is a significant diversity in device specifications.
- Security Concerns
- Mobile apps often handle sensitive data, making security a top priority. However, ensuring the security of an app, particularly when it involves financial transactions or personal information, can be challenging. Developers must constantly update their apps to protect against emerging threats like malware, phishing, and data breaches.
- User Experience and Interface Design
- Creating an intuitive and user-friendly interface is crucial for the success of a mobile app. However, designing an interface that is both aesthetically pleasing and functional across various devices and screen sizes requires careful planning and testing. Poor user experience can lead to high churn rates, where users abandon the app shortly after downloading it.
- Monetization Strategies
- While there are several ways to monetize mobile apps, such as in-app purchases, advertisements, and subscription models, finding the right balance between profitability and user satisfaction can be difficult. Excessive ads or expensive in-app purchases can drive users away, while a lack of monetization can make it challenging for developers to sustain their apps.
The Future of Mobile Applications
As technology continues to evolve, so too will mobile applications. Several trends are expected to shape the future of this industry.
- Artificial Intelligence and Machine Learning
- The integration of artificial intelligence (AI) and machine learning (ML) into mobile apps is expected to become more prevalent. AI-driven features like personalized recommendations, voice assistants, and chatbots will enhance user experience and provide more tailored services. For instance, apps like Google Assistant and Siri already leverage AI to assist users in their daily tasks.
- Augmented Reality and Virtual Reality
- Augmented reality (AR) and virtual reality (VR) are set to revolutionize the way we interact with mobile apps. These technologies will create immersive experiences, particularly in gaming, shopping, and education. Apps like Pokémon Go and IKEA Place have already demonstrated the potential of AR, and we can expect to see more innovative applications in the future.
- 5G Connectivity
- The rollout of 5G networks promises to significantly enhance the performance of mobile apps. With faster download and upload speeds, lower latency, and improved connectivity, 5G will enable more complex and data-intensive applications. This will pave the way for advancements in areas like real-time gaming, video streaming, and IoT (Internet of Things) applications.
- Blockchain Technology
- Blockchain technology has the potential to revolutionize mobile apps, particularly in areas like finance, supply chain management, and data security. Decentralized apps (dApps) built on blockchain platforms offer greater transparency, security, and user control. As blockchain technology matures, we can expect to see more mobile apps leveraging its capabilities.
- Wearable Technology Integration
- As wearable devices like smartwatches and fitness trackers become more sophisticated, the integration of mobile apps with these devices will become more seamless. This will lead to the development of apps that offer more personalized and real-time data, particularly in health and fitness. The synergy between mobile apps and wearables will enhance the overall user experience and open up new possibilities for app developers.
Conclusion
Mobile applications have come a long way since their inception, evolving from simple tools to complex platforms that drive innovation across various industries. Their impact on sectors like healthcare, education, finance, and entertainment cannot be overstated. As we look to the future, advancements in technology, such as AI, AR/VR, 5G, and blockchain, will continue to shape the mobile app landscape, offering exciting opportunities for developers and users alike.
However, with these opportunities come challenges, including security concerns, platform fragmentation, and the need for effective monetization strategies. Developers must navigate these challenges to create apps that not only meet the demands of users but also push the boundaries of what is possible.
In a world where smartphones are ubiquitous, mobile applications have become a vital part of our daily lives. As the industry continues to evolve, it will be fascinating to see how mobile apps continue to influence and enhance the way we live, work, and connect.
FAQs:
Q. What is the mobile application?
A. A mobile application, or app, is a software program designed to run on smartphones, tablets, and other mobile devices. It allows users to perform specific tasks, access services, or entertain themselves through their mobile device. Apps can be downloaded and installed from app stores like Google Play or the Apple App Store.
Q. What are the three 3 types of mobile application?
A. The three types of mobile applications are:
Hybrid Apps: Combine elements of native and web apps, using web code within a native container.
Native Apps: Built for specific platforms (iOS, Android) with platform-specific code.
Web Apps: Mobile-optimized websites accessed through a browser.
Q. How do I start a mobile application?
A. To start a mobile application:
Launch: Publish on app stores and promote it.
Plan: Define your app’s idea and target platform.
Design: Create a user-friendly interface.
Develop: Write the code or use a development tool.
Test: Ensure the app works smoothly.
Q. What is mobile application form?
A. A mobile application form is a digital form designed to be filled out on a mobile device, such as a smartphone or tablet. It allows users to input information, submit requests, or register for services directly through a mobile app or mobile-optimized website. These forms are typically used for tasks like sign-ups, surveys, bookings, or data collection.
Q. What is a mobile application called?
A. A mobile application is commonly called an “app.”
Leave a Comment